Mon premier programme
Objectifs
Délais
Plan de câblage
Le micro-processeur est chargé d'exécuter un programme afin de traiter les informations issues des capteurs et d'envoyer des ordres aux actionneurs.
Les capteurs et actionneurs sont reliés au micro-processeur sur différentes connexions.
Les capteurs permettent de fournir des informations au micro-processeur, ils sont donc reliés sur les entrées.
Afin de savoir où est relié chaque capteur, les entrées sont repérées par un numéro.
Le microprocesseur va traiter ces informations et en fonction du programme, va envoyer des ordres à la partie chaîne d'énergie.
Comme il peut y avoir plusieurs actionneurs, les sorties sont aussi numérotées.
Le schéma précédent peut se simplifier en ne mettant en évidence que les entrées et sorties du micro-processeur : on utilise alors un plan de câblage.
Pour ce premier programme, nous avons choisi de brancher les capteurs et actionneur comme illustré sur le PLAN DE CABLAGE suivant :
Algorithme
La première chose à faire pour réaliser un programme est de réfléchir au fonctionnement souhaité.
Voici le cahier des charges de notre premier programme :
Après une demande d'ouverture du portail, ouvrir le vantail jusqu'à ce que le Fin de Course "FC vantail ouvert" soit touché.
A partir de cela on va pouvoir construire l’algorithme qui permettra de décrire le fonctionnement du programme en français.
Codage
Étape suivante : transformer cet algorithme dans le langage du micro-processeur. C'est l'étape du CODAGE.
Il existe de nombreux langages de programmation qui sont pratiquement tous en anglais.
Dans le cas des micro-processeurs PICAXE, il s'agit d'un langage graphique n'utilisant que quelques instructions que nous découvrirons au fil de nos programmes.
Nous verrons dans une autre activité, pourquoi il faut agir sur les sorties 0 et 1 pour faire tourner le moteur dans un sens donné.
Réaliser le programme avec le logiciel PICAXE
Dernière étape pour ce premier programme : lancer le logiciel PICAXE EDITOR 6
- CHOISIR le micro-processeur Picaxe18M2+
- DÉCOUVRIR comment on code l'instruction "Ouvrir vantail" :
Comme on veut commander plusieurs sorties en même temps, il est préférable de choisir l'instruction OUTPUTS et coder les sorties comme indiquées ci-dessous :
- SAISIR le codage du programme dans le logiciel PICAXE EDITOR 6 : Lancer Picaxe Editor 6 et cliquer sur FlowChart pour ouvrir un nouveau programme.
- SIMULER le fonctionnement dans le logiciel PICAXE EDITOR.
-
Last modifiedmercredi 13 janvier 2021